City, Edinburgh, United Kingdom Hybrid / WFH Options
Lloyds Bank plc
IaC (Terraform). Build Tools & DevOps principles: Git, Maven, Jenkins CI/CD, Nexus, SonarQube. SQL/NoSQL database, Basic Unix/Linux Skills, TDD using JUnit. It would be great if you also had Experience in Spring Boot and Hibernate. Experience in JavaScript or other front-end technologies. Experience More ❯
ll collaborate with cross-functional teams to create highly performant and scalable solutions. Key Responsibilities: Deliver high-quality, well-structured code using Agile and TDD practices Develop new features across the full stack , from React/TypeScript front-end to Java-based backend services Build and optimize search solutions using More ❯
City, Edinburgh, United Kingdom Hybrid / WFH Options
ENGINEERINGUK
such as git, unit testing and integration testing tools, mocking frameworks. Strong analytical and software architecture design skills with an emphasis on testdrivendevelopment Great analytical, problem-solving and communication skills. Some experience or a real interest in finance, investment processes, and/or an ability More ❯
performant solutions that help end users derive real value from complex data. Key Responsibilities Write clean, maintainable, and well-tested code following Agile and TDD practices Contribute to both backend services (Java) and modern front-end frameworks (React/TypeScript) Develop and fine-tune search functionality using technologies like Lucene More ❯
glasgow, central scotland, United Kingdom Hybrid / WFH Options
Eden Scott
performant solutions that help end users derive real value from complex data. Key Responsibilities Write clean, maintainable, and well-tested code following Agile and TDD practices Contribute to both backend services (Java) and modern front-end frameworks (React/TypeScript) Develop and fine-tune search functionality using technologies like Lucene More ❯
develop realistic and achievable project estimates. Analysis and build within Control, Stability, Resiliency, Capacity & Performance areas. Create automated unit tests using a TestDrivenDevelopment approach Testing: Unit, SIT & UAT planning and management. Robust delivery of code into the production environment with zero tolerance for post implementation More ❯
The stack includes .Net Core, Azure, SQL, and Angular , and they really care about doing things properly, from clean code and good architecture to TDD and SOLID principles. It's a mature engineering environment where quality genuinely matters. There's also plenty of scope for growth opportunities to take on More ❯
The stack includes .Net Core, Azure, SQL, and Angular , and they really care about doing things properly, from clean code and good architecture to TDD and SOLID principles. It's a mature engineering environment where quality genuinely matters. There's also plenty of scope for growth opportunities to take on More ❯
time role, remote, with one quarterly visit to their Glasgow office. What You’ll Do: Deliver high-quality code using Agile and TestDrivenDevelopment methodologies. Develop and maintain domain knowledge based on customer use-cases and industry practices. Turn requirements into well-structured software that meets More ❯
time role, remote, with one quarterly visit to their Glasgow office. What You’ll Do: Deliver high-quality code using Agile and TestDrivenDevelopment methodologies. Develop and maintain domain knowledge based on customer use-cases and industry practices. Turn requirements into well-structured software that meets More ❯
technologies such as Oracle and Cassandra. Proficiency in Spring Integration/Batch for data orchestration, Agile methodologies, CI/CD pipelines, and test-drivendevelopment is essential. Strong debugging and code quality skills required. Open for both Contracts (inside IR35) & Permanent roles More ❯
technologies such as Oracle and Cassandra. Proficiency in Spring Integration/Batch for data orchestration, Agile methodologies, CI/CD pipelines, and test-drivendevelopment is essential. Strong debugging and code quality skills required. Open for both Contracts (inside IR35) & Permanent roles More ❯
time role, remote, with one quarterly visit to their Glasgow office. What You'll Do: Deliver high-quality code using Agile and TestDrivenDevelopment methodologies. Develop and maintain domain knowledge based on customer use-cases and industry practices. Turn requirements into well-structured software that meets More ❯
syntax of at least one programming language with limited guidance Creates Automated Unit Tests with Flexible/Open Source Frameworks using a TestDrivenDevelopment approach Designs, develops, codes, and troubleshoots with consideration of upstream and downstream systems and technical implications Applies knowledge of tools within the More ❯
City, Edinburgh, United Kingdom Hybrid / WFH Options
ENGINEERINGUK
practices (SLOs, burn down alerting). Experience with IaC development (Terraform, Crossplane, etc.) using agile and CI/CD best practices (testdrivendevelopment, progressive deployment). Experience with systems configuration management and automation systems (Puppet, Ansible) is a plus. Our benefits To help you stay More ❯
provided in all these areas if needed: • AngularJS • jQuery • ReactJS • .NET 5 • Windows Forms programming • Developing and consuming REST services • OOP (Object Oriented Programming) • TDD This role is urgent in nature so please email your CV to mitesh.fatnani@change-digital.co.uk or call 077 375 38 248 for more information. More ❯
edinburgh, central scotland, United Kingdom Hybrid / WFH Options
Change Digital – Digital & Tech Recruitment
provided in all these areas if needed: • AngularJS • jQuery • ReactJS • .NET 5 • Windows Forms programming • Developing and consuming REST services • OOP (Object Oriented Programming) • TDD This role is urgent in nature so please email your CV to mitesh.fatnani@change-digital.co.uk or call 077 375 38 248 for more information. More ❯
require you to go through Security Clearance. Therefore, you must hold British Citizenship. All the teamwork adhering to best in industry techniques such as TDD, CI and Paired Programming. THE BENEFITS Bonus 25 days Holiday Paid for Certifications Healthcare Flexible hours Annual trips abroad THE JAVA DEVELOPER ROLE: You’ll More ❯
glasgow, central scotland, United Kingdom Hybrid / WFH Options
Searchability®
require you to go through Security Clearance. Therefore, you must hold British Citizenship. All the teamwork adhering to best in industry techniques such as TDD, CI and Paired Programming. THE BENEFITS Bonus 25 days Holiday Paid for Certifications Healthcare Flexible hours Annual trips abroad THE JAVA DEVELOPER ROLE: You’ll More ❯
a proactive member of an agile development team, focusing on efficient application delivery to meet business KPIs Promote best practices in Test-DrivenDevelopment (TDD), development tools, and technologies Actively participate in agile ceremonies and interact with business owners, stakeholders, and other teams across the … click deployment capability Help shape pricing and workflow strategy and tooling within the organization Requirements: Practical experience in building Java applications Strong Test-DrivenDevelopment (TDD) experience Proficiency with Agile development methodologies and systems engineering Experience in build and release management principles, including continuous integration and More ❯
a proactive member of an agile development team, focusing on efficient application delivery to meet business KPIs Promote best practices in Test-DrivenDevelopment (TDD), development tools, and technologies Actively participate in agile ceremonies and interact with business owners, stakeholders, and other teams across the … click deployment capability Help shape pricing and workflow strategy and tooling within the organization Requirements: Practical experience in building Java applications Strong Test-DrivenDevelopment (TDD) experience Proficiency with Agile development methodologies and systems engineering Experience in build and release management principles, including continuous integration and More ❯
City, Edinburgh, United Kingdom Hybrid / WFH Options
TieTalent
depth knowledge and experience of CI/CD practices. Strong knowledge and experience of Test-Driven approaches to software engineering (ATDD, BDD & TDD). Demonstration of an 'automation first' mentality and be adept at finding the right balance between automated, exploratory, functional, and non-functional testing. If this More ❯
as in banking and financial services topics. You'll engage in an 8-week full-stack training program covering Microservices & APIs, UI test-drivendevelopment, database management, and Azure fundamentals. Role and Responsibilities Reporting to the Development Manager, you will be involved in the design, developmentMore ❯
code quality, making use of version control tools Engage in the development of software using a clear process e.g. Agile, DevOps, TestDrivendevelopment Undertake development in accordance with scope outlined in Project Definition Documents (PDD) Create and update documentation and accessibility of software solutions More ❯
Glasgow, Renfrewshire, United Kingdom Hybrid / WFH Options
Searchability
role will require you to go through Security Clearance; therefore, you must hold British Citizenship. All teamwork adheres to best industry practices such as TDD, CI, and Paired Programming. THE JAVA DEVELOPER ROLE: You will be joining a Financial Services client in Glasgow, working 2 days per week onsite. In More ❯